    Description

    Windbit WAP1241-IBE is built on a powerful next-generation hardware platform engineered to deliver outstanding wireless performance in ultra-high-density enterprise environments. Its advanced quad-radio Wi-Fi 7 architecture combines dedicated 2.4 GHz, dual 5 GHz/6 GHz radios, and an independent AI radio that continuously monitors and optimizes the RF environment. Supporting up to 12 spatial streams, MU-MIMO, OFDMA, and ultra-high-order 4096-QAM modulation, the platform achieves an impressive peak throughput of up to 17.98 Gbps, ensuring smooth, responsive connectivity even with a large number of concurrent users. High-capacity wired connectivity is enabled through multigigabit interfaces, including a 10GBASE-T Ethernet port and a 10GE SFP+ interface, offering deployment flexibility over copper or fiber backhaul. Additional Ethernet, USB, and Bluetooth interfaces extend IoT and service capabilities, making Windbit WAP1241-IBE a robust, future-ready hardware foundation for demanding Wi-Fi 7 enterprise networks.

    Key Features

    Advanced 4096-QAM technology

    With 4096-QAM modulation and 802.11be, the maximum access speed can reach 17,89 Gbps. With all radios activated simultaneously, a high-speed and highly efficient Wi-Fi 7 experience is achieved.

    High security and reliability

    It supports cyclic shift/delay diversity (CDD/CSD), maximum ratio combination (MRC), space-time block coding (STBC), and low-density parity checking (LDPC).

    Channel width up to 320MHz

    The channels can be 20 MHz, 40 MHz, 80 MHz, 160MHz, and 320 MHz.

    Wireless Intruder Detection System (WIDS)

    And user isolation, detection and containment of unauthorized access points. CPU Protection Policy (CPP). Network Foundation Protection Policy (NFPP).

    Orthogonal Frequency-Division Multiple Access (OFDMA)

    OFDMA allows multiple users to simultaneously receive/send packets through the AP, minimizing user contention and data forwarding, thereby reducing latency and improving network efficiency.

    Improved signal quality

    Encryption and authentication technologies including WPA3, 802.1X and PPSK, ensuring secure communications, advanced access control and comprehensive data protection in corporate environments. 

    High number of BSSIDs

    Network administrators can encrypt and isolate separate VLANs or subnets of the same SSID, with specific authentication methods for each SSID. Supports up to 48 (16 BSSIDs per radio).

    IPv4/IPv6 Services

    DHCPv4 server, NAT4, neighbor discovery (ND), ICMPv6, IPv6 DHCP client, static routing, PPPoE client, IPsec VPN.
